- The speedy destruction of the wicked, and the preservation of the godly.
--This psalm is almost the same as the last five verses of Ps 40. Whil here we behold Jesus Christ set forth in poverty and distress, we als see him denouncing just and fearful punishment on his Jewish, heathen and antichristian enemies; and pleading for the joy and happiness of his friends, to his Father's honour. Let us apply these things to ou own troubled circumstances, and in a believing manner bring them, an the sinful causes thereof, to our remembrance.
